Granola

  • βœ“Users absolutely love the product β€” everyone at Granola genuinely cares about quality
  • βœ“Plenty of opportunities to work on things that make a real difference on a small team
  • βœ—5 days in office by default (with flexibility for life circumstances)
  • βœ—Small team, so things can be busy β€” you'll wear many hats

Ramp

  • βœ“Exceptional talent and product-driven culture β€” software engineers rate 4.7/5 on Glassdoor
  • βœ“Outstanding compensation and benefits β€” 16 weeks maternity, IVF coverage, free lunch
  • βœ—Intense work demands β€” 60+ hour weeks and 10-12 hour days are common
  • βœ—Shifting to in-office preference β€” new hires expected 3+ days/week in NYC, SF, or Miami
Granola
Choose Granola if you want to work on one of the most loved AI products with a small, London-based, in-office team obsessed with craft β€” but note the 5-days-in-office policy is explicit and non-negotiable.
Ramp
Choose Ramp if you want top-tier comp and a product-driven fintech culture β€” but expect 60+ hour weeks and in-office expectations.

Granola scores 4.8/5.0 on Glassdoor with a 4.5 work-life balance rating. Ramp scores 4.2/5.0 overall with a 3.5 WLB. That’s a 0.6-point gap on overall satisfaction.

Both companies share these culture values: Engineering-Driven, Ship Fast & Iterate, Strong Comp & Equity, Direct Product Impact. Granola also emphasizes Wears Many Hats. Ramp also emphasizes Transparent, Learning & Growth.

On the hiring front, Granola has 16 open roles and Ramp has 128 open roles.
